What’s a Good KD in GTA 5?
In Grand Theft Auto V (GTA 5), the Kill-to-Death (KD) ratio is a crucial metric that measures a player’s performance in multiplayer mode. A good KD ratio indicates a player’s ability to take down opponents while minimizing their own deaths. In this article, we’ll explore what constitutes a good KD in GTA 5 and provide insights on how to improve your own KD ratio.
Direct Answer: What’s a Good KD in GTA 5?
A good KD in GTA 5 is subjective and depends on various factors, including the player’s skill level, game mode, and playstyle. However, based on general consensus and data analysis, a KD ratio above 1.5 is considered good, while a ratio above 3.0 is exceptional.
Factors Affecting KD Ratio
Several factors influence a player’s KD ratio in GTA 5, including:
- Game Mode: The type of game mode played can significantly impact a player’s KD ratio. For example, in free-for-all modes, a high KD ratio is easier to achieve, while in team-based modes, coordination and teamwork are crucial.
- Playstyle: A player’s playstyle, such as aggressive or defensive, can affect their KD ratio. Aggressive players may have a higher KD ratio, while defensive players may have a lower ratio.
- Skill Level: A player’s skill level, including their aim, movement, and reaction time, can significantly impact their KD ratio.
- Opponent’s Skill Level: The skill level of opponents can also affect a player’s KD ratio. Playing against better opponents can lead to a lower KD ratio, while playing against weaker opponents can result in a higher ratio.
KD Ratio Breakdown
Here’s a breakdown of the KD ratio in GTA 5:
| KD Ratio | Description |
|---|---|
| 0.0-0.5 | Very poor, indicating a high death-to-kill ratio. |
| 0.5-1.0 | Poor, indicating a moderate death-to-kill ratio. |
| 1.0-1.5 | Average, indicating a balanced death-to-kill ratio. |
| 1.5-3.0 | Good, indicating a high kill-to-death ratio. |
| 3.0+ | Excellent, indicating an exceptional kill-to-death ratio. |
Improving Your KD Ratio
To improve your KD ratio in GTA 5, follow these tips:
- Practice Aim: Improve your aim by practicing in free aim mode or using aim-assist.
- Improve Movement: Enhance your movement skills by practicing strafing, jumping, and using cover.
- Play Smart: Play strategically, using cover, and flanking opponents to gain an advantage.
- Communicate: Communicate with your team to coordinate strategies and set up ambushes.
- Stay Focused: Stay focused and avoid distractions, such as getting caught up in a firefight or chasing after opponents.
